Vic: Montana grandfather shocked by double life

MELBOURNE, Aug 12 AAP - The grandfather of baby Montana today said he was shocked to
discover his daughter's partner had reportedly been leading a double life with another
family interstate.
The Herald Sun newspaper reported today that Joe Barbaro's Canberra family did not
know of his double life until a national plea for his baby daughter Montana's return last
weekend after she was kidnapped from a Melbourne shopping centre.
Nick Ciancio told AAP he had not yet spoken to his daughter Anita Ciancio about the
claims today that her partner and Montana's father also has another family living in Canberra.
"I am in total shock," an emotional Mr Ciancio said.
"I am currently reading the newspaper but this is the first time I have heard about this."
When asked if he had spoken to his daughter about the claims, Mr Ciancio replied: "no".
He refused to make any further comment until he had spoken with his family.
According to the newspaper Giuseppe Dom Barbaro, 48 - also known as Joe Barbaro - will
also face serious drugs charges later this year.
His shocked Canberra fiancee Tanya Flynn said Mr Barbaro had moved her and their two
children, Letesha, six, and Jay, three, interstate three years ago.
She said they knew nothing of him also having two children with Anita Ciancio - Montana,
four weeks, and Sienna, 19 months, the newspaper reported.
Ms Flynn reportedly said she was devastated when she found out.
"He has been telling us that we are his only family - he was going to be coming to
live with us," she told the newspaper.
"It's been absolutely traumatic to find this out, especially like this."
A married couple have been charged with kidnapping Montana after it was alleged they
snatched the baby from her mother, Ms Ciancio, at the Brimbank Central Shopping Centre
in western suburban Deer Park on Saturday.
Montana was found alone but unharmed in a derelict house in North Melbourne on Monday.
